Lidia Chiarelli: artist, poet and co-founder of the art-literary Movement Immagine & Poesia.

After visiting the Museum of Modern Art in New York in 2010, Lidia was inspired to create installations similar to Yoko Ono’s Wish Tree, but hanging not only wishes, but poems and original works of art on cards on the trees.  Lidia Chiarelli’s “Poetry&Art Trees” thus began to appear in different exhibitions in Italy and abroad. She is also an appreciated collagist artist.

Gianpiero Actis (Torino, Italy). Eye surgeon and artist, with permanent exhibitions in the UK (Swansea, Wales).

In 2007 co-founder of the art-literary Movement “Immagine & Poesia”.  Jury member for the Arts at Turin Live Festival
